Greece - Naphtha Available for Final Consumption

Since 2014, Greece Naphtha Available for Final Consumption was up 45.8%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 18 comparing other countries in Naphtha Available for Final Consumption with 321.71 Gigawatthours. Greece is overtaken by Finland, which was number 17 with 1,378.22 Gigawatthours and is followed by Turkey at 187.29 Gigawatthours. Germany lead the ranking with 97,973.33 Gigawatthours in 2019, -6.5% compared to 2018. Netherlands, Italy and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Greece recorded the best 5 years average growth at +45.8% per year, while Turkey recorded the worst performance at -53.9% per year.
